package com.sleepycat.bind.serial; import com.sleepycat.bind.EntityBinding; import com.sleepycat.je.DatabaseEntry; import de.ovgu.cide.jakutil.*; /** * An abstract <code>EntityBinding</code> that treats an entity's key entry * and data entry as serialized objects. * <p> * This class takes care of serializing and deserializing the key and data entry * automatically. Its three abstract methods must be implemented by a concrete * subclass to convert the deserialized objects to/from an entity object. * </p> * <ul> * <li> {@link #entryToObject(Object,Object)} </li> * <li> {@link #objectToKey(Object)} </li> * <li> {@link #objectToData(Object)} </li> * </ul> * @author Mark Hayes */ public abstract class SerialSerialBinding implements EntityBinding { private SerialBinding keyBinding; private SerialBinding dataBinding; /** * Creates a serial-serial entity binding. * @param classCatalogis the catalog to hold shared class information and for a * database should be a {@link StoredClassCatalog}. * @param keyClassis the key base class. * @param dataClassis the data base class. */ public SerialSerialBinding( ClassCatalog classCatalog, Class keyClass, Class dataClass){ this(new SerialBinding(classCatalog,keyClass),new SerialBinding(classCatalog,dataClass)); } /** * Creates a serial-serial entity binding. * @param keyBindingis the key binding. * @param dataBindingis the data binding. */ public SerialSerialBinding( SerialBinding keyBinding, SerialBinding dataBinding){ this.keyBinding=keyBinding; this.dataBinding=dataBinding; } public Object entryToObject( DatabaseEntry key, DatabaseEntry data){ return entryToObject(keyBinding.entryToObject(key),dataBinding.entryToObject(data)); } public void objectToKey( Object object, DatabaseEntry key){ object=objectToKey(object); keyBinding.objectToEntry(object,key); } public void objectToData( Object object, DatabaseEntry data){ object=objectToData(object); dataBinding.objectToEntry(object,data); } /** * Constructs an entity object from deserialized key and data objects. * @param keyInputis the deserialized key object. * @param dataInputis the deserialized data object. * @return the entity object constructed from the key and data. */ public abstract Object entryToObject( Object keyInput, Object dataInput); /** * Extracts a key object from an entity object. * @param objectis the entity object. * @return the deserialized key object. */ public abstract Object objectToKey( Object object); /** * Extracts a data object from an entity object. * @param objectis the entity object. * @return the deserialized data object. */ public abstract Object objectToData( Object object); }
